Somatosensory dysfunction is a widely reported clinical consequence of chemical exposure. Assessment of such dysfunction should be an important component of agent safety testing, necessarily implying evaluation of psychophysical functions in laboratory animals. The logic of testing agent-induced sensory dysfunction, conceptual and practical factors affecting such tests, and the categories of experimental methods available are reviewed.
